Dear All,
I have an old egyptian floppy screensaver program I bought years ago before I even knew about linux. It is a windows program. I want to transfer the floppy program to cd since my husband's winxp machine has no floppy drive. I tried opening the floppy from sidux with mount and I got it to open but it would only let me copy some of the files to a folder that I created and refused to finish the copy.
Would I be able to use sftp from my husband's winxp computer and open the floppy from his winxp then copy it there? I have used sftp between my two linux computers and it worked great. I have not done it between a winxp and sidux machine yet. I would like to use filezilla on his machine. I used Krusader in sidux and linuxmint.
Any way to open this floppy that I own to copy to cd so that it can be used in my husband's winxp machine will be greatly appreciated. Thanks.
